Summer Heat

Mumbai’s summer heat …twice a year…. May and October
Sweltering, humid, perspiration beads dripping down 
Like a drunkard staggering in crowded trains and metro
Waiting to rush into your airconditioned office
Yes we are there… sipping sweet lemon juice 
A sweet relief to nature’s torment
